Understanding the Correlation Between CPU and GPU Performance

The CPU-GPU Relationship

The CPU and GPU are two essential components of a gaming PC. The CPU handles tasks such as game logic, AI processing, and physics calculations, while the GPU handles graphics rendering. While both components are important, the CPU and GPU need to work together in harmony to deliver a smooth gaming experience. A bottleneck can occur if one component is significantly more powerful than the other. For example, if you have a powerful GPU but a weak CPU, the CPU may not be able to feed the GPU with data fast enough, resulting in lower performance.

CPU Core Count and Clock Speed

The CPU’s core count and clock speed are two critical factors that affect its performance. Core count refers to the number of physical cores on the CPU, while clock speed measures how fast each core can execute instructions. A CPU with more cores can handle more tasks simultaneously, while a CPU with a higher clock speed can execute instructions faster. For gaming, both core count and clock speed are important. However, the ideal balance between the two will vary depending on the game you are playing.

Typically, games that are heavily dependent on AI or physics calculations will benefit more from a CPU with a higher core count. On the other hand, games that are primarily focused on graphics rendering will benefit more from a CPU with a higher clock speed. Here is a general guideline for choosing a CPU for gaming:

Game Type CPU Core Count CPU Clock Speed
AI-heavy or physics-based games 6 or more Moderate
Graphics-intensive games 4 or more High

The Impact of Motherboard and RAM on CPU and GPU Performance

The motherboard is the backbone of a gaming PC, connecting all the components and facilitating communication between them. It plays a crucial role in determining the performance of the CPU and GPU.

Motherboard Chipset

The motherboard chipset is the bridge between the CPU and the rest of the system. It determines the number of PCIe slots, USB ports, SATA ports, and other features available on the motherboard. A higher-end chipset will typically support more features and provide better performance.

Socket Type

The socket type on the motherboard must match the socket type of the CPU. If they do not match, you will not be able to install the CPU.

PCIe Slots

PCIe slots are used to connect the GPU to the motherboard. The number and type of PCIe slots available will determine the number and type of GPUs you can install. PCIe 4.0 slots provide higher bandwidth than PCIe 3.0 slots, resulting in improved GPU performance.

Memory Capacity and Speed

The amount of RAM and its speed can also impact the performance of the CPU and GPU. More RAM allows for more programs and data to be stored in memory, reducing the need for the CPU to access slow storage devices like the hard drive. Higher RAM speeds enable faster data transfer between the RAM and the CPU, improving overall system performance.

RAM Capacity RAM Speed Performance Impact
8GB 2133MHz Adequate for basic gaming
16GB 2666MHz Recommended for most gaming setups
32GB 3200MHz Ideal for high-end gaming and multitasking

Adjusting Image Size and Resolution

To ensure a clear and high-quality print, it’s crucial to adjust the image size and resolution appropriately.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

1. Determine the Locket Size and Resolution

Begin by measuring the locket’s image area to determine the required image size. Most lockets have a standard image size that ranges between 12mm to 25mm. You can refer to the locket’s specifications or consult a jeweler for accurate measurements.

2. Adjust Image Resolution and Dimensions

The ideal resolution for printing a small picture for a locket is between 300-600 DPI (dots per inch). A higher resolution results in a sharper image, but it also increases the file size.

Resolution (DPI) Recommended for
300-400 Small lockets (up to 18mm image area)
400-500 Medium lockets (18-22mm image area)
500-600 Large lockets (22-25mm image area)

Once you have determined the resolution, calculate the image dimensions using the formula:

Image Width (Pixels) = Image Area (mm) x Resolution (DPI) / 25.4

Image Height (Pixels) = Image Area (mm) x Resolution (DPI) / 25.4

For example, if you have a locket with an image area of 18mm and want to print at 400 DPI, the image dimensions would be:

Width = 18mm x 400DPI / 25.4 = 283 pixels

Height = 18mm x 400DPI / 25.4 = 283 pixels

Choosing the Appropriate Paper and Ink

Selecting the right paper and ink is crucial for achieving high-quality prints for your locket. Here’s a detailed guide to help you make the best choice:

Paper Type

Paper Type Description
Photographic Paper Glossy or matte surface specifically designed for high-quality photo printing, providing vibrant colors and sharp details.
Cardstock Thicker and more durable than regular paper, suitable for creating stiff and sturdy prints that can withstand handling.
Tracing Paper Transparent or translucent paper that allows you to trace the image, ensuring accuracy when transferring it to the locket.

Ink Type

Ink Type Description
Dye-Based Ink Produces vibrant colors and smooth gradients but may be less durable and prone to fading over time.
Pigment-Based Ink Provides long-lasting prints with excellent resistance to fading and water damage, but colors may appear less saturated.
Sublimation Ink Specially formulated ink that is transferred to the locket through heat, resulting in highly durable and water-resistant prints.
